本发明涉及一种用于硅凝胶的粘结促进剂,特别涉及一种用于提高硅凝胶粘度的粘结促进剂,属于胶粘剂技术领域。The invention relates to an adhesion promoter for a silicone gel, in particular to an adhesion promoter for increasing the viscosity of a silicone gel, and belongs to the technical field of adhesives.
在工业界中,可适用于透明光学元件上的粘接剂有环氧树脂粘结剂、橡胶型粘结剂、改性丙烯酸树脂粘结剂、聚氨酯粘结剂等材料。In the industry, adhesives which can be applied to transparent optical elements include epoxy resin adhesives, rubber type adhesives, modified acrylic resin adhesives, and polyurethane adhesives.
环氧树脂的缺点在于耐黄变性能比较差,同时,其抗开裂和冲击的性能也有欠缺。橡胶型粘结剂的缺点是储存稳定性差。聚氨酯粘结剂缺点是耐温性比较差,高温下易水解。目前被广泛使用的触摸屏用OCA水胶由于成本和售价太高,而且工艺繁琐,有比较大的局限性。硅凝胶虽然具有较好的透明度,但是因其粘性低而无法直接用作透明光学元件的粘结剂。The disadvantage of epoxy resin is that the yellowing resistance is relatively poor, and at the same time, its resistance to cracking and impact is also lacking. A disadvantage of the rubber type adhesive is poor storage stability. The disadvantage of polyurethane binders is that the temperature resistance is relatively poor and it is easy to hydrolyze at high temperatures. OCA water gel for touch screens, which are currently widely used, has relatively large limitations due to the high cost and price, and the cumbersome process. Although silicone gel has good transparency, it cannot be directly used as a binder for transparent optical elements because of its low viscosity.
